British "dog of war" on trial, faces 32 years jail

MALABO (Reuters) - British mercenary Simon Mann, one of Africa's last "dogs of war", went on trial in Equatorial Guinea on Tuesday and the prosecution asked he be jailed for nearly 32 years for his role in a failed 2004 coup plot. [ VIEW FULL COVERAGE @Reuters: International News ]  |
